Abstract

The initial results of efforts in the modeling identification, and control of flexible structures, and the four experimental setups in various stages of construction are described. They are a single-link flexible beam, a two-dimensional flexible plate, a two-link flexible manipulator, and a five-axis flexibly jointed robot.
